Background

On 3/21/07, the Division of the Budget issued Bulletin D-1119 providing payment of 2007 Performance Advances and Longevity Payments for eligible Management Confidential employees.

Eligibility

Performance Advance Requirements

M/C employees in graded and NS equated positions whose base annual salary is below the Job Rate of the employee's current position and who have thirteen (13) complete pay periods of service in such position between April 1, 2006 and March 31, 2007 are eligible for a Performance Advance based on the 4/1/07 Salary Schedule.

Longevity Payment Requirements

M/C employees in grades 603 - 617 who complete five (5) or ten (10) years of continuous service as defined by Section 130.3(c) of the Civil Service Law at a base annual salary equal to or greater than the Job Rate of the employee's grade may be eligible for a Longevity Payment. The Longevity Payment is effective from the first day of the pay period following completion of the required service. For employees with an Increment Code of 2002 or 1997 who have had continuous paid service, the Longevity Payment is effective 3/29/07 (Institution) and 4/5/07 (Administration).

OSC Actions

After payroll processing is completed for Pay Period 1L, OSC will process Performance Advances and Longevity Payments for eligible graded and NS equated to grade employees whose status on 3/29/07 (Institution) and 4/5/07 (Administration) is Active, on Paid Leave of Absence (except Sick Leave) or on Workers’ Compensation Leave.

Performance Advance (Increment Code 0001)

OSC will automatically insert a row in the employee’s Job Data page effective 3/29/07 (Institution) and 4/5/07 (Administration) to reflect the Performance Advance (not to exceed the Job Rate) using the Action/Reason code of Pay Rate Chg/PAV (Pay Rate Change/Performance Advance).

Promotion Recalculation (Increment Code 0004)

OSC will automatically insert a row in the employee’s Job Data page effective 3/29/07 (Institution) and 4/5/07 (Administration) to reflect the FIS (Fixed Incremented Salary) amount on the Job Data Compensation page as long as the FIS amount is greater than the compensation rate on Job Data, using the Action/Reason code of Pay Rate Chg/PMR (Pay Rate Change/Promotion Recalculation).

Longevity Payments (Increment Codes 2002 and 1997)

OSC will automatically process Longevity Payments for employees in grades 603-617 with an Increment Code of 2002. Employees who are at Job Rate will be brought to Longevity Step 1. Employees above the Job Rate and below Longevity Step 1 will have $750.00 added to the employee's salary. The Action/Reason code of Pay Rate Chg/LGP (Pay Rate Change/Longevity Payment) will be used.

OSC will automatically process Longevity Payments for employees in grades 603-617 with an Increment Code of 1997 whose salary is at or above Longevity Step 1 and below Longevity Step 2. Employees will be brought to Longevity Step 2. The Action/Reason code of Pay Rate Chg/LGP (Pay Rate Change/Longevity Pay) will be used.

Transactions processed automatically will appear on the NHRP520, Daily Outbound Transaction file.

Automatic Update of Increment Codes

OSC will automatically update the increment codes, as appropriate, for employees in Pay Period 1L. Employees who receive Performance Advances or Promotion Recalculations will have their increment codes updated on the Performance Advance or Promotion Recalculation row. After the Performance Advances are processed in Pay Period 1L, OSC will automatically update increment codes of employees with Increment Code 0003 on the Job Data record using the Action/Reason code of Data Change/CIC (Data Change/Correct Increment Code) effective 3/29/07 (Institution) and 4/5/07 (Administration).

Agency Actions - Pay Period 1

Graded Employees and NS Employees Equated to Grade

The following procedures must be used by the agency when reporting transactions in Pay Period 1L:

For Pay Changes, Position Changes and Transfers requested on the Job Action Request or Transfer Request page and the effective date of the Action is on or before 3/29/07(Institution) or 4/5/07 (Administration):

  • The agency must not include the Performance Advance or Longevity Payment in the salary rate reported in the Pay Rate field.
  • The agency must report the April 2007 Increment Code.

For Pay Changes, Position Changes and Transfers requested on the Job Action Request or Transfer Request page and the effective date of the Action is after 3/29/07 (Institution) or 4/5/07 (Administration):

  • The agency must include, if applicable, the Performance Advance or Longevity Payment in the salary reported in the Pay Rate field.
  • The agency must report the projected increment code for April 2008.

Employees who are on paid Sick Leave at the time of payment:

  • Employees on paid Sick Leave will not receive payments automatically.
  • The agency must enter a request on the Job Action Request page using the appropriate Action/Reason code of Pay Rate Change/PAV (Performance Advance or Pay Rate Change/PMR (Promotion Recalculation) for employees who become eligible for the payments before being placed on paid Sick Leave.
  • The agency must enter a request on the Job Action Request page using the appropriate Action/Reason code of Pay Rate Change/LGP (Longevity Pay) for employees who are eligible at the time of the payment.

If the agency determines that an M/C employee’s automatic Performance Advance should be withheld, the agency must submit a Job Action Request using the Action/Reason code of Data Change/PWH (Data Change/Performance Advance Withheld) and enter the Increment Code 0003 effective 3/29/07 (Institution) or 4/5/07 (Administration).

For NS equated to grade employees due a Longevity Payment, the agency must submit the Action/Reason code of Pay Rate Change/LGP (Longevity Payment).

Time Entry

To report miscellaneous earnings automatically calculated by the system (i.e. overtime), agencies must separate earnings by pay period so the earnings will not overlap the effective date of the pay change.

Agency Actions - Pay Period 2

Beginning in Pay Period 2L, agencies that submit Rein Leave transactions on the Job Data page for eligible employees who return from a Leave of Absence without Pay (except Workers’ Compensation Leave) or a Paid Leave of Absence with a reason of Sick Leave or MLS (Military Stipend) with an effective date after Pay Period 1 must also enter the Action/Reason code of Pay Rate Change/PAV, effective the date of the Rein Leave with the next effective sequence number.

If the effective date of the Rein Leave is before Pay Period 1, the agency must submit the Rein Leave and any additional rows to add the Performance Advance or Promotion Recalculation (Pay Rate Change/PAV or Pay Rate Change/ PMR) if applicable, effective 3/29/07 (Institution) or 4/5/07(Administration).
